His dad played for UNC, but outfielder Vance Honeycutt is making a name for himself with Tar Heels
Posted May 24, 2022
North Carolina freshman outfielder Vance Honeycutt truly discovered his UNC baseball lineage in high school when his dad, Bob, dug through the closet and produced a ring from the Tar Heels’ 1989 College World Series appearance he was a part of. His dad never harped on his UNC legacy, but now Honeycutt is on his way to establishing his own.
